Default unfortunately might have to sell, whats it worth?

Unfortunately i'm thinking of selling the impreza (Nige's old car!), reason being i think i'm going to need a bike again for work for the 80 mile daily commute to london. I only use the car a few times a month and can't justify running two cars and a bike at the same time.

reason for post is i have no idea of what the car is worth in the current climate, dealers tend to be selling impreza's for stupid money, people who advertise their prized possessions on other forums seem to get shot down for the prices their asking! And i can't find anything for a similar spec to mine for sale at the minute.... if i can justify keeping it then i won't sell it but this seems the only logical way at the moment long term.

any thoughts or advice would be appreciated

spec as below....
2009 sti 2.5 short engine
Scoobyclinic TD05-20G turbo
Hdi Front Mounted intercooler
Oil catch can
K & N induction Kit
Group N engine Mounts
Walbro Fuel Pump
Roger Clark Motorsport Oil pump
Exedy Organic Clutch kit
25 row Oil cooler
Deatsch werks 650cc Injectors
Simtek ECU with anti lag on switch fitted and mapped by JGM (been told it has launch control too but never tried it and don't know how to use it)
HKS Hi Power exhaust system
Decat pipes
Harvey Smith Headers and up pipe

BC Coilovers - with extenders on rear shocks
front and rear sti strut braces
whiteline anti lift kit
whiteline anti roll bars
subframe spacers
drop link kit

18x9 Rota G-Force alloys
Bridgestone Potenza tyres
Brembo front and rear brakes

polyurethane front splitter
Morette headlight conversion
foglights covered up for fmic pipes
22b rear spoiler

Standard sti buckets front and rear
Boost gauge and Oil Temp Gauge housed in pillar
Sony Stereo with Bluetooth Mp3 and built in handsfree
Sparco steering wheel

Sigma Alarm
Tracker


cars done 78k now with the ej25 block being put in at 64800k, was recently serviced at slowboy racing and given a clean bill of health
